Population Growth as a Primary Driver

Edmondson Park has seen a significant population increase over the past few years. This growth is primarily due to an influx of families seeking suburban living, drawn by affordable housing and community amenities. With more residents comes a natural increase in demand for essential services, such as childcare.

As families settle into this vibrant community, their needs evolve. Parents are looking for reliable childcare solutions that can support their work-life balance. The sheer number of young children entering the area underscores the pressing need for high-quality early education options.

Moreover, as new developments continue to emerge, projections indicate this trend will persist. More residents mean more children who require care and educational resources during those formative years. Childcare providers must adapt swiftly to meet these growing demands or risk falling behind in such a competitive market.

The Supply Challenge for Local Providers

Local childcare providers in Edmondson Park face significant supply challenges. The increasing demand for quality care often outpaces the available resources, leading to overcrowding and long waitlists. Many centres are struggling to keep up with the rising number of families seeking services, leaving parents frustrated.

Staff shortages further complicate this issue. Qualified educators and caregivers are in high demand across the region, making it challenging for local facilities to hire and retain talent. This impacts not only the quality of care but also operational capacity, as fewer staff members translate into limited enrollment.

Additionally, many providers lack adequate funding to expand their facilities or improve services. Rising costs for staffing, equipment, and regulatory compliance make it challenging for them to scale operations effectively. As a result, meeting community needs becomes an uphill battle amid growing pressure from families seeking trustworthy childcare options.
